The spacing of sequences as well as the improbable hybridization in some partial sequences recommend that band merchandise visualized from typing are not caused by exclusive hybridization to ERIC sequences, and also the primers, therefore, function, at the very least to some jir.2011.0094 extent, as low-stringency arbitrary primers. The ERIC-PCR system is very comparable to, if not always, a RAPD assay. The longer length of the ERIC-PCR (22 bp) compared with 10?2 bp in standard RAPD primers seems to boost the efficiency of primers plus the robustness from the assay compared with RAPDs.20 While a national and possibly international standardized typing protocol and database, like the database applied by PulseNet, has an unquestionable worth in determining the movement of strains more than wide geographic areas, other typing solutions, which include ERIC-PCR, also may have vital complementary roles. ERIC-PCR yields final analyzable images 8 hours right after the extraction of DNA. The PulseNet 12-hour protocol doesn't yield final benefits for 36 hours, simply because the gel runs for 22 hours immediately after the initial 12 hours required for lysis, washes, and enzyme digestion. The cost of ERIC-PCR is eight per isolate, which compares well using the expense of PFGE which is commercially supplied at 75.21 Standard gels and electrophoresis units used for PCR-ERIC enable for far more specimens to be concurrently evaluated. The BEZ235 structure approach calls for no specialized gear or reagents within a laboratory with PCR capabilities. Simply because the number of organisms which can be successfully typed with ERIC-PCR continues to develop to include diarrheogenic22 and MLN1117 site uropathogenic E. coli,23 Pseudomonas aeruginosa,24 Aeromonas hydrophila,25 Vibrio parahemolyticus,26 Stenotrophomonas,24 Klebsiella pneumoniae,27 Yersinia enterocolitica,28 Bartonella henselea,29 and Helicobacter pylori,20 the advantage of adopting this method in the hospital and regional level also increases. Experience with this simplified technique enables for the preliminary investigation of several critical nosocomial or regional outbreaks without having the have to have for a disease-specific approach immediately after main culture. The amount of patterns analyzed drastically exceeds suggestions for visual band evaluation.18 Bands classified as faint had been ignored in their comparative analysis. Obviating visible bands for the duration of a comparative analysis might cause oversimplification of band patterns, specially in typing techniques exactly where the amount of bands per pattern is somewhat low (ERIC-PCR and RAPD-PCR). In addition, we located that each repeatability and complexity of patterns had been enhanced by DNA quantification just before the assay, a step that is generally element of PFGE and RAPD protocols but not described in ERIC protocols. ERIC sequences are short (127 bp), imperfect palindromic sequences present in Enterobacteracaea also as Vibrio cholerae. Recent genomic perform on ERIC sequences in Escherichia coli and Shigella revealed that S. flexneri 2a 301 has 15 full-length and 11 partial-length ERIC sequences, S. dysenteriae Sd197 has 12 full-length and eight partial-length copies, journal.pone.0174724 S. sonnei Ss046 has 18 full-length copies and 11 partialcopies, and S. boydii Sb227 has 19 full-length copies and 10 partial-length copies.19 All copies have been chromosomal.
